Joe Elliott is an accomplished and adroit axe wielder currently based in Los Angeles, California (U.S.A.) who represents his playing style as fusion ("an eclectic mix of everything i've ever played"), as a music fan can now experience on his most recent recording, "Joe's Place". His workhorse guitars consist of a Ted Kellison custom "Strat" model and a Martin 0018E. Elliott has been playing guitar since 1971, and putting it simply, divulges his career objective, "To continue earning my living playing guitar, teaching guitar, and writing/recording music."
When asked to finally make public his favorite or most used effect for the guitar, Elliott unflinchingly stated, "None," and continued by outlining his musicial goals, "My tunes are really a result of my brain mixing up the gazillion songs I've played gigging all these years." He maintains a desire to, at some point, study arranging for an orchestra, and is at the moment listening to Robben Ford, Scott Henderson and Joe Pass. His principal gratification? "Musically, I'd have to say having an entire song (head,comping, and solo) flow like a natural event," he explains absolutely.
Elliott wraps up by noting long-term and forthcoming endeavors enthusiastically, by saying, "My band is starting a new CD project in April of 1999."
